Real-Life Decision Making -- Solution

You accept the donation.

You take the donation and create an exhibit with the man's family heirlooms. Your actions cause an uproar in the community. Many people feel the museum has sacrificed its principles by allowing someone to "buy their way" into an exhibit.

Several local organizations send letters stating they will not be making any more donations to the museum as a result of this incident.

This is not the decision that curator Lisa Paice would make. "It was a really tough decision to make. But if I accepted the donation, it would have seemed like the museum was up for grabs -- like we were displaying the history of anyone who could afford to make a big donation."
